Large-scale water and electricity pipeline installation overhead hoist
Technical Field
The utility model belongs to building engineering construction field, in particular to large-scale water and electricity pipeline installation overhead hoist.
Background
In the building engineering construction, there are a large amount of water and electricity pipelines, the work of laying of fire-fighting pipeline, this part of pipeline is mostly great in weight ratio, in traditional construction, constructor often adopts many workman's manual work transport together, the form of dragging carries out the transportation installation, but because the construction equipment layer height on general equipment layer is all higher, construction operation personnel generally all need set up auxiliary device such as scaffold frame in carrying out the transport installation of pipeline, this has just increased the construction volume at to a great extent, construction cost has been increased, also lead to construction work inefficiency at to a great extent and reduced the efficiency of construction, construction period's extension and then delay construction period scheduling problem.

Drawings
Fig. 1 is a schematic structural diagram of an embodiment of the present invention.
Reference numerals: 1. a base; 2. moving the roller; 3. vertically supporting the telescopic rod; 31. an outer rod; 32. an inner rod; 33. a first clamping hole; 34. a second clamping hole; 4. a fine adjustment rod; 5. a top pallet; 6. a transverse support bar; 7. a connecting ring; 8. a motor; 9. a hoisting rope; 10. a hook is buckled; 11. and (5) a rotating structure.
Detailed Description
The technical solutions of the present invention are described in detail below by way of examples, which are only exemplary and can be used only for explaining and explaining the technical solutions of the present invention, but not for explaining the limitations of the technical solutions of the present invention.
As shown in fig. 1, a large-scale water and electricity pipeline installation overhead hoist, including base 1, the removal gyro wheel 2 of area brake is installed to base 1 bottom, the removal gyro wheel 2 of area brake is the part commonly used, the mounting means is conventional to pass through the bolt and install on base 1, vertical support telescopic link 3 is installed on base 1's top, vertical support telescopic link 3's top is provided with screw thread and threaded connection has fine-tuning pole 4, fine-tuning pole 4's top fixedly connected with top layer board 5, top layer board 5 supports on the structure roof, vertical support telescopic link 3 is provided with two here, fixedly connected with horizontal bracing piece 6 on two vertical support telescopic links 3, the bottom of horizontal bracing piece 6 is provided with go-between 7, fixed mounting has motor 8 on base 1, motor 8 is connected with hoist rope 9, hoist rope 9 crosses go-between 7 and the end is provided with couple buckle 10, the connection buckle can be connected with the pipeline strapping of handling.
The use does, remove base 1, through the height of the horizontal support telescopic link of 3 adjustments of vertical support telescopic link, rethread fine-tuning pole 4 supports the roof and realizes fixing on the structure roof, the pipeline that needs the handling is connected to couple buckle 10, realize the handling work of direction of height under the drive of motor 8, the efficiency of construction has been improved greatly, the cost is reduced, the extension of having avoided construction period and then postpone construction period scheduling problem, the energy-conserving technological level of a green building in the field of building engineering exquisiteness construction has been improved.
Vertical support telescopic link 3 is provided with a plurality of card holes 33 including connecting outer pole 31 on base 1 and cup jointing interior pole 32 in outer pole 31 on interior pole 32 along the direction of height, and the top of outer pole 31 is provided with two 34 in the card hole that correspond, wears to establish card hole 33 and card hole two 34 through the round pin and connects outer pole 31 and interior pole 32, and vertical support telescopic link 3's height can conveniently realize the adjustment.
Outer pole 31 threaded connection is on base 1, and 6 threaded connection of horizontal bracing piece is at the top of pole 32 in, and horizontal bracing piece 6 has the steel member of external screw thread for both ends, because the length of pole 32 is shorter in the connection of horizontal bracing piece 6, can install successfully, and the device can be comparatively convenient carry out the dismouting, go-between 7 fixed connection is on horizontal bracing piece 6, supplies hoist rope 9 to pass.
The fine tuning pole 4 is fixedly provided with a long-strip-shaped rotating structure 11, the rotating structure 11 is arranged in the middle of the fine tuning pole 4, a part of threads below the rotating structure 11 are screwed into the vertical supporting telescopic rod 3, the fine tuning pole 4 can rotate for fine tuning through an optional mounting structure, and the operation is convenient and labor-saving. The motor 8, the hoisting rope 9 and the connecting ring 7 are arranged at two positions, and the two positions can ensure the hoisting safety. The top supporting plate 5 is a square plate, and the square plate is good in butt joint effect, stable and firm.
The base 1 is a steel plate, two motor 8 installation reserved positions are arranged above the base, two ends of the base are respectively provided with an accessory supporting rod piece installation position, and four corners below the base are respectively provided with a movable roller 2 installation position; the movable roller 2 is arranged on the lower portion of a base 1 plate and comprises an external connecting portion, a roller and a braking device, the upper portion of the external connecting portion is of a plane structure and is provided with four connecting bolt holes for connecting the external connecting portion with the base 1 plate, the lower portion of the external connecting portion is provided with a bearing connecting structure for connecting the roller, and the braking device is further arranged, so that locking and rolling control of the roller is achieved, and the base 1 is simple in structure, convenient to manufacture and low in cost.
The hoist rope 9 is steel strand wires, and one end and motor 8's rotation axis connection to the winding is on the go-between 7 of horizontal bracing piece 6, and one end has the connection buckle, and its connection buckle can be connected with the pipeline strapping of handling, realizes the fixed and handling to the pipeline, and steel strand wires's intensity is high, and the security is high.
Motor 8 is connected with control system, control system includes the signal line, open and stop the switch, the direction of motion switch is constituteed, control motor 8's operation is opened and is stopped and the operation direction, motor 8 power is not less than two kilowatts, and it can realize forward and reverse two-way rotation, and every minute hoist speed is not less than 1m, its axis of rotation is connected with hoist rope 9, realize hoist rope 9's hoist and whereabouts, the control of device is convenient simple, motor 8's control is no longer repeated here.
